> I am not sure whether I have chosen the right email in the thread but:
> a x86-64 GNU Linux build currently fails as follows.
> 
> At a glance, it seems to be sufficient to remove the prototype
> declaration in i386.cc.
> 
> Namely:
> 
> gcc/config/i386/i386.cc:107:12: error: 'rtx_def*
> legitimize_dllimport_symbol(rtx, bool)' declared 'static' but never
> defined [-Werror=unused-function]
>    107 | static rtx legitimize_dllimport_symbol (rtx, bool);
>        |            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
> 
> gcc/gcc/config/i386/i386.cc:108:12: error: 'rtx_def*
> legitimize_pe_coff_extern_decl(rtx, bool)' declared 'static' but never
> defined [-Werror=unused-function]
>    108 | static rtx legitimize_pe_coff_extern_decl (rtx, bool);
>        |            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
> ^Cmake[3]: *** [Makefile:2556: i386.o] Interrupt
> 
> There is:
> 
> config/i386/i386.cc:static rtx legitimize_dllimport_symbol (rtx, bool);
> config/mingw/winnt-dll.cc:legitimize_dllimport_symbol (rtx symbol, bool
> want_reg)
> config/mingw/winnt-dll.cc:      return legitimize_dllimport_symbol
> (addr, inreg);
> config/mingw/winnt-dll.cc:        rtx t = legitimize_dllimport_symbol
> (XEXP (XEXP (addr, 0), 0), inreg);
> 
> 
> And:
> 
> config/i386/i386.cc:static rtx legitimize_pe_coff_extern_decl (rtx, bool);
> config/mingw/winnt-dll.cc:legitimize_pe_coff_extern_decl (rtx symbol,
> bool want_reg)
> config/mingw/winnt-dll.cc:    return legitimize_pe_coff_extern_decl
> (addr, inreg);
> config/mingw/winnt-dll.cc:      rtx t = legitimize_pe_coff_extern_decl
> (XEXP (XEXP (addr, 0), 0), inreg);
>
